中文摘要zns:mn nanoparticles of the cubic zinc blende structure with the average sizes of about 3 nm were synthesized using a coprecipitation method and their optical and magnetic properties were investigated. two emission bands were observed in doped nanoparitcles and attributed to the defect-related emission of zns and the mn2+ emission, respectively. with the increase of mn2+ concentration, the luminescence intensities of these two emission bands increased and the zns emission band shifted to lower energy. based on the luminescence excitation spectra of mn2+, the 3d(5) level structure of mn2+ in zns nanoparticles is similar to that in bulk zns:mn, regardless of mn2+ concentration. magnetic measurements showed that all the samples exhibit paramagnetic behavior and no antiferromagnetic interaction between mn2+ ions exists, which are in contrast to bulk zns:mn.
